The episode explores Amy Howe's journey to becoming the CEO of FanDuel, highlighting the challenges and strategies in navigating the rapidly evolving sports betting industry. Howe discusses her transition from Ticketmaster during the COVID-19 pandemic to leading FanDuel, emphasizing the importance of the company's values and the need for agility in a volatile market. She addresses the complexities of legalizing online sports betting in California, focusing on collaboration with tribal entities and the potential impact on tribal sovereignty. The conversation also covers the role of AI in enhancing user experience and ensuring responsible gaming, as well as FanDuel's efforts to promote women's sports and responsible gambling practices.
